Sales Executive - DACH
FitFlop
We’re looking for a highly commercial and ambitious Sales Executive to gain new partners across the DACH region, in-line with the strategic priorities of the FitFlop. You will be responsible for managing, selling and servicing the existing regional account base and capturing on further opportunities. Responsible for long-term development of the accounts within the DACH region, you’ll ensure profitable growth as well as building strong relationships with our buyers.
A flexible self-starter with experience working in wholesale within a regional based role, ideally in the footwear or apparel industry. You will have had exposure to reporting and communicating both sell-in and sell-through. You will demonstrate self-assurance, pride and passion and exude personal and professional impact. You are obsessive about customer service and are visibly energetic and enthusiastic about business improvement opportunities.
The Responsibilities:
- To develop, manage and be accountable for the sales of the existing regional account base in line with the brand building guidelines
- Responsible for pre-season sell-in, planning and forecasting on account level
- Managing the in-season business and replenishment for the regional accounts
- Providing product trainings, sales support and participate during partner events
- Supporting the marketing team on visual merchandising and the execution of in-store events
- Ownership of all administration as required
- Drive service excellence and execute strategic direction within specific countries
- To grow and control the sales of provided account base within territory and in line with the brand building guidelines.
- Acquisition of new partners in accordance with distribution strategy
- Execution and preparation, of the seasonal product forecasts for the account base
- Develop the profitability of the business with all accounts, manage and collate key sales information through to the Sales Manager of DACH
Prebook & Reorder:
- Plan, budget each account by category, vs. LY & target
- Strategically plan and arrange all customer appointments
- In line with each customer’s budget successfully carry out sales appointments working from dedicated showrooms during key periods
- Ensure all orders and admin is submitted within deadlines
- Strategically plan then carry out the sales strategy; by phone daily or in person
Customer/Account Management:
- Build a strong professional relationships with all buyers or owners for each account
- Strategically contact and manage your customers daily, weekly or bi monthly
- Attain and use wisely weekly sales data
- Plan the strategic and profitable use of marketing tools
- Visit all accounts and doors
- Propose new accounts or opportunities to your People Leader (Sales Manager – EMEAI North)
- Be the first point of call for your accounts within the FIFLOP organization
Brand:
- Be the coordinator and first point of call for your territory within FITFLOP
- Report back to your People Leader with any requested information on your territory
- Liaise with internal departments credit control, customer services and marketing
- Ensure that within your territory, the brand is presented in the best possible way and always in line with the most current brand guidelines
The Person:
- You’ll be a fantastic communicator with excellent verbal and written skills
- Highly numerate, and able to budget and forecast using Microsoft Excel
- Excellent presentation skills
- Experience in related industry (footwear would of course be a benefit, but not essential)
- Previous wholesale experience in a regionally based role is a must
- You’ll have had exposure to reporting and communicating both sell-in and sell-through
- Ability to perform and multi-task in a collaborative, quick paced, agile company
- Experience using Microsoft Office Suite - Excel, Word, Outlook, PowerPoint, etc.
- Able to define the fashion landscape for FitFlop and an awareness of current brand adjacencies
- You’ll be a self-starting, conscientious and able to use your initiative
- You’ll be able to use rigorous logic and methods to solve difficult problems with effective solutions, managing stakeholder relationships as you do this
- Look beyond the obvious and don’t stop at the first answers to ensure you’re always able to provide detailed analysis
- Digital awareness is key
- Action orientated and full of energy for things you see as challenging
- Extensive travel and occasional overnight stays are expected throughout and across Germany, Austria, Switzerland and the UK.
- Fluent in German and English a must (French and Italian language skills are beneficial)
- Full and valid driving license required
